Sony A9 III Black 2023
Why we recommend this ▼
The global shutter sensor eliminates rolling shutter distortion entirely, enabling 120fps bursts with full AF/AE and flash sync up to 1/80,000 sec. The bundled FE 70-200mm f/2.8 GM OSS II lens and spare battery provide a ready-to-shoot kit with professional-grade optics and backup power. This camera is best for sports and wildlife photographers who need distortion-free capture of ultra-fast action.

Hasselblad X2D 100C graphite grey 2025
Why we recommend this ▼
Its 100MP medium-format sensor captures 16-bit color depth and 15.3 stops of dynamic range, while 10-stop IBIS stabilizes handheld shots. Hasselblad's Natural Color Solution with HDR delivers true-to-life hues, and the new AF-C system with subject detection and LiDAR improves focus tracking. Best for studio, product, and landscape photographers who demand uncompromising resolution and color fidelity.

Hasselblad Medium Format Mirrorless Camera 907X & CFV 100C 2024
Why we recommend this ▼
Combining a 100MP medium format BSI CMOS sensor with the modular CFV 100C digital back, this system delivers immense resolving power in a design that bridges Hasselblad's V-System legacy with modern mirrorless operation. The retro-inspired build and compatibility with classic lenses offer a tactile, deliberate shooting experience absent from most modern cameras. It is best for studio photographers and fine art landscape specialists who prioritize maximum image detail and manual focus workflows over speed or video capabilities.
